Understanding the Challenges
Heavy-duty and passenger vehicle operators face several pressing challenges, including rising fuel costs, regulatory compliance, and the need for enhanced safety measures. Addressing these issues is crucial for enhancing overall fleet performance and minimizing operational disruptions.
1. Fuel Efficiency
Fuel consumption accounts for a major portion of operating expenses for vehicle fleets.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, improving fuel efficiency by just 10% can lead to a substantial reduction in costs. Moreover, employing advanced technologies such as aerodynamic designs and lighter materials can facilitate this improvement.
2. Maintenance Costs
Routine maintenance is key to vehicle longevity. A study by the American Trucking Association states that fleets that adopt proactive maintenance strategies can decrease maintenance-related downtime by 25%. This translates to more time on the road and less on repairs, addressing both performance and efficiency.
3. Driver Safety
Enhancing driver safety is paramount, as the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) reports that a significant percentage of accidents involve driver error. Integrating adv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) into both heavy-duty and passenger vehicles can lower accident rates by up to 40%.

Key Solutions for Improved Performance
To tackle these challenges head-on, three core strategies can help boost performance across the board.
1. Advanced Technology Implementation
Incorporating telematics and real-time monitoring systems can help fleet managers make informed decisions. For example, using GPS tracking and performance analytics can improve route efficiency by 15%, reducing fuel costs and improving delivery times.
2. Employee Training Programs
Investing in driver training programs can enhance safety and efficiency. A case study from Fleet Owner highlighted that companies that provided regular safety training saw a 30% drop in accident rates, showcasing the direct impact on performance.
3. Regular Performance Assessments
Conducting regular assessments can identify performance bottlenecks. Utilizing performance dashboards and analytics tools allows fleet managers to view vital metrics and take corrective actions swiftly, resulting in enhanced operational efficiency.
Real-World Applications
Consider the case of ABC Logistics, which faced high operational costs due to inefficient routing and fuel usage. After implementing advanced telematics, they reduced fuel costs by 20% within six months by optimizing routes and increasing accountability among drivers.
